Product Description  
The GLS87CA016G2 / 032G2 / 064G2 Industrial  
Temperature SATA M.2 2242 ArmourDrive™ MX  
Series modules (referred to as “M.2 ArmourDrive” in  
this factsheet) are high-reliability solid state drives.  
They include a 16, 32 or 64 GByte SATA NANDrive™  
on a printed circuit board (PCB).  
the Flash File System (FFS) and Memory Technology  
Driver (MTD). The firmware effectively optimizes the  
use of NAND flash memory’s program/erase (P/E)  
cycles and minimizes write amplification.  
M.2 ArmourDrive is pre-programmed with a 10-Byte  
unique serial ID and has the option of programming  
an additional 10-Byte serial ID for even greater  
system security.

GENERAL DESCRIPTION  
Each M.2 ArmourDrive module contains a NANDrive multi-chip package, which integrates a SATA NAND flash  
controller with discrete NAND flash die. Refer to Figure 2-1 for the M.2 ArmourDrive block diagram.  
1.1.5  
Error Correction Code (ECC)  
1.1  
Optimized M.2 ArmourDrive  
The ECC technology uses advanced algorithms to  
detect and correct errors, ensuring data integrity and  
extending the SSD lifespan.  
The heart of M.2 ArmourDrive is the SATA NAND  
flash controller, which translates standard SATA  
signals into flash media data and control signals. The  
following components contribute to M.2 ArmourDrive’s  
operation.  
1.1.6 Multi-tasking Interface  
The multi-tasking interface enables fast, sequential  
write performance by allowing concurrent Read,  
Program and Erase operations to multiple flash media.  
1.1.1 Microcontroller Unit (MCU)  
The MCU translates SATA commands into data and  
control signals required for flash media operation.  
1.2  
Advanced NAND Management  
1.1.2 Internal Direct Memory Access (DMA)  
M.2 ArmourDrive’s SATA controller uses advanced  
wear-leveling algorithms to substantially increase the  
longevity of NAND flash media. Wear caused by data  
writes is evenly distributed in all or select blocks in the  
device that prevents “hot spots” in locations that are  
programmed and erased extensively. This effective  
wear-leveling technique results in optimized device  
endurance, enhanced data retention and higher  
reliability required by long-life applications.  
M.2 ArmourDrive uses internal DMA allowing instant  
data transfer from/to buffer to/from flash media. This  
implementation eliminates microcontroller overhead  
associated with the traditional, firmware-based  
approach, thereby increasing the data transfer rate.  
1.1.3 Power Management Unit (PMU)  
The PMU controls the power consumption of M.2  
ArmourDrive. The PMU dramatically reduces the  
power consumption of M.2 ArmourDrive by putting the  
part of the circuitry that is not in operation into sleep  
mode.  
The Flash File System handles inadvertent power  
interrupts and has auto-recovery capability to ensure  
M.2 ArmourDrive firmware integrity. For regular power  
management,  
the  
host  
must  
send  
an  
IDLE_IMMEDIATE command and wait for command  
ready before powering down M.2 ArmourDrive.  
1.1.4 Embedded Flash File System  
The embedded flash file system is an integral part of  
M.2 ArmourDrive. It contains MCU firmware that  
performs the following tasks:  
1. Translates host side signals into flash media  
writes and reads  
2. Provides flash media wear leveling to spread the  
flash writes across all memory address space to  
increase the longevity of flash media  
3. Keeps track of data file structures  
4. Manages system security for the selected  
protection zones
